The Workshop:

During this workshop you will make your own Oktoberfest-inspired mug.

Isabella will demonstrate slab-building techniques and show you how to stamp and carve relief designs into your mug! Finish your mug with underglaze pigments to bring your deisgns to life. Glazed pieces are foodsafe, dishwasher safe, and microwave safe.

During the workshop, please photograph your artwork so you can identify it when it comes out of the kiln. Thank you!



After the Workshop + Pickup:

The ceramic artworks will be fired in a kiln at the gallery. Approximately 4 weeks after the workshop, you will receive an email when they are ready to be picked up. You can also check our website here to see if your pieces are ready to be picked up.
